Output aef628ddd79a98fcecc2cb9fb1e255903ceee6f1e8462b2e83e6d0ef658f3a21:10

value
19765901874
script pubkey
OP_0 OP_PUSHBYTES_32 99c3225ce78fb5d15ada566fb83093c61a67c74a2b7c861471cdc364f2235922
address
bc1qn8pjyh88376azkk62ehmsvynccdx03629d7gv9r3ehpkfu3rty3qh6j0mm
transaction
aef628ddd79a98fcecc2cb9fb1e255903ceee6f1e8462b2e83e6d0ef658f3a21
spent
true